As bombs explode

by Lost Girl   Jul 11, 2005


Each face stricken with horror as the news is said aloud
A million different people, but loved ones are amid the crowd
Tears stream from the eyes of hundreds in fear of defeat
No way of contacting their family and friends they long to meet

All I do is stand here so useless, back pressed against the wall
Looking out for others who prepare themselves for their fall
Parents working in the town, took the tube in to work today
I hear the whispers on the wind, praying that they will be ok

A school brought to madness, each child has lost all hope
If their families were hurt, how are they to ever cope?
Each one on their mobiles trying to find a guarantee
That everyone will be ok, but none of this worries me

I know that I am safe from harm, so I am numb within my shell
Watching out on suffering as others lives crumble to hell
Another bomb explodes and once more the fragments fall
Every familiar face beside me is praying for that reassuring call

What is it all leading to? Another war, more suffering and pain?
Why is this all happening now, and will it happen again?
Once they have heard those caring voices, the can rest their load
But more fear begins to rise as today more bombs explode
